At tonight’s BAFTAs in London, Margot Robbie is nominated in the leading actress category for her work in Greta Gerwig’s Barbie—so it’s no wonder she and stylist Andrew Mukamal nodded to the iconic doll with her choice of red carpet attire. Once again embracing method dressing in Barbie pink, the star chose a custom look from Armani Privé (which famously created her pink sequined gown at this year’s Golden Globes). This time around, however, the look was very much Old Hollywood—but fit for a modern-day A-lister.

Robbie’s strapless pink and black dress featured a built-in sequined bralette and was accessorized with a pair of black opera gloves. The retro-glamorous silhouette and matching gloves called to mind the strapless Schiaparelli gown she wore to the LA premiere of the film last year, which served as a nod to the 1960 “Solo in the Spotlight” Barbie—though this time, of course, there was way more pink. When it came to jewelry, the star went rather minimal, opting for dangling diamond earrings that lent a dazzling shimmer. 

The finished ensemble was likely a reference to a specific archival Barbie; most of Robbie’s red carpet looks while promoting the film have nodded to one of Mattel’s vintage designs. But Mukamal has yet to post the inspiration on Instagram—so check back for more when it’s unveiled.
